Seasonal Care Tips for Your Newly Set Up Colorbond Fence

Taking care of your fence through different seasons will significantly extend its life expectancy and maintain its visual appeal. Below are some seasonal pointers:

Spring Care Tips

Inspecting for Winter Damage

After winter season, inspect your fence for any damage triggered by snow or ice. Keep an eye out for rust spots or dents.

Cleaning Your Fence

Spring cleaning isn't just for inside! Use moderate soap and water to wash off dirt and gunk that collected over the winter season months.

Summer Care Tips

Regular Checks

During hot summer days, inspect your fence routinely for signs of fading or rust due to sun exposure.

Watering Close-by Plants

If you have plants near your fence, ensure they're appropriately watered but avoid splashing water directly onto the fence surface as it might cause staining over time.

Autumn Care Tips

Leaf Accumulation

Fallen leaves can trap moisture versus the base of your fence. Make certain you clear them away regularly before they start decomposing versus the metal barrier.

Prepping for Winter

As autumn winds down, check if any screws or bolts require tightening before winter season sets in.

Winter Care Tips

Snow Removal

Inspecting Sealants

Check any sealants used during setup; they may need reapplication after a couple of winters depending on wear and tear.

Common Misconceptions About Colorbond Fencing

Myth 1: They're Loud During Rain

Reality: Contrary to popular belief, Colorbond fences are developed to minimize noise throughout rain thanks to their solid building materials.

Myth 2: They Rust Easily

Reality: While they are made from steel, modern-day production strategies make them resistant to rust when effectively maintained.

FAQs about Colorbond Fencing Maintenance

1. How typically should I clean my Colorbond fence?

Cleaning once every 6 months need to be sufficient unless there has actually been heavy rains or dust storms that need more frequent attention.

2. Can I paint my Colorbond fence?

While painting is possible, it's advised that you seek advice from professionals as inappropriate painting can void guarantees or affect performance.

3. What ought to I do if I see rust?

Rust needs to be addressed right away with sandpaper followed by using touch-up paint specifically created for usage on metal surfaces.

4. How do I get rid of spots from my fence?

Use moderate soap blended with water; scrub gently using a soft cloth or sponge-- not abrasive materials that might scratch the surface!

5. Is there service warranty protection on my brand-new fence?

Most manufacturers offer service warranties varying from 10 years up depending upon quality; constantly validate before purchasing!

6. Do all colors fade similarly under sunlight exposure?

Generally speaking, darker colors might fade faster than lighter shades due to heat absorption-- this differs by manufacturer so check specifics!
